Replaced both the headlight and driving light bulbs with 5k HID's with 35W ballast's. With the "reflector" over the headlight bulb, there is no nasty glare, and the driving lights are low enough to not be annoying either. My old S-10 had 55W ballasts in high and low, but without the "reflector" over the bulb, they were nasty bright! I liked them, but nobody else did. Replaced both on my F-150 for just under $100 to my door.
